Job Description

West Fraser offers a range of exciting career opportunities for individuals seeking challenging and rewarding careers. Cariboo Pulp is currently recruiting for a Journeyperson Carpenter.

Reporting to the Maintenance Supervisor, the Carpenter will be responsible for working safely in all areas on the mill site. They will be a key player in company-wide continuous improvement efforts.

You'll Do:

  • Scaffolding
  • Building repairs and maintenance
  • Building and repairing cabinets
  • Office renovations
  • Office furniture assembly
  • Forming and concrete work
  • Equipment base grouting

You have:

  • A valid Red Seal Carpenter certification
  • Masonry and Scaffolding experience
  • Heavy industry experience
  • Commitment to working safely and creating a safe work place
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
  • Able to work independently as well as part of a team
  • A valid Class 5 Drivers License

Compensation Package:

  • The hourly pay rate for this position will follow the collective agreement between Unifor 1115 and Cariboo Pulp Ltd., which is currently $48.66/hour.

We make renewable, wood-based building products for the world, contributing to a more sustainable future. Today, West Fraser is one of the world’s largest producers of sustainable wood-based building products, with more than 60 facilities in Canada, the United States, the United Kingdom, and Europe. From responsibly sourced and sustainably managed forest resources, West Fraser produces lumber, engineered wood products (oriented strand board, laminated veneer lumber, medium-density fibreboard, plywood, and particleboard), pulp, newsprint, wood chips, other residuals, and renewable energy. West Fraser’s products are used in home construction, repair and remodeling, industrial applications, papers, tissue, and boxes.
